Culinary Historians of Piedmont North Carolina (CHOP NC) is a group of people who love and enjoy learning about food, history, culinary traditions, foodways, kitchen culture, ingredients, and more. We meet monthly (usually the third Wednesday 7 pm - 8:30 pm at Flyleaf Books) and also host special events throughout the year. Visit our website: http://www.chopnc.com Follow us on Twitter: @chopnc
Most southern cooks will agree with Debbie Moose when she
writes, "Like a full moon on a warm southern night, buttermilk makes
something special happen." Buttermilk explores the rich possibilities of
this beloved ingredient and offers remarkably wide-ranging recipes for its use
in cooking and baking--and drinking, including The Vanderbilt Fugitive, a
buttermilk-based cocktail.
Buttermilk includes fifty recipes--most of which are uniquely southern, with some decidedly cosmopolitan additions--from Fiery Fried Chicken to Lavender Ice Cream to Mango-Spice Lassi. For each recipe, Moose includes background information, snappy anecdotes, and preparation tips. Replete with helpful hints and advice for finding the best quality buttermilk available, this cookbook is indispensable for anyone who wants to learn more about this tangy cooking staple.
Debbie Moose is an award-winning food writer and author
of five cookbooks, including Deviled Eggs: 50 Recipes from Simple to Sassy and
Potato Salad: 65 Recipes from Classic to Cool.
